How Electric Car Batteries Work
Understanding how electric car batteries function is essential for anyone interested in the evolution of sustainable transportation. Electric vehicles (EVs) rely on rechargeable batteries, primarily lithium-ion batteries, which convert electrical energy into mechanical energy to power the vehicle.The Basics of Electric Car Batteries
An electric car's battery acts as a reservoir for energy. It stores electricity generated by various sources, mainly the electric grid or regenerative braking systems. The energy stored in the battery can then be released to power the vehicle's electric motor.Components of Electric Car Batteries
Most electric vehicle batteries consist of cells grouped together into modules. Each cell consists of an anode, cathode, and electrolyte. When the battery discharges, lithium ions flow from the anode to the cathode, creating an electric current that powers the vehicle. Conversely, during charging, the process is reversed.Charging Mechanisms
Electric car batteries can be charged using various methods, including Level 1 (standard household outlets), Level 2 (dedicated home or public charging stations), and DC fast chargers that provide rapid charge times. The ability to charge efficiently is crucial for EV owners who want to maximize their driving range.Battery Management Systems
To ensure the longevity and efficiency of electric car batteries, Battery Management Systems (BMS) monitor and manage the battery’s state. These systems help maintain optimal temperature, state of charge, and overall health of the battery pack, preventing overheating and prolonging lifespan.Environmental Impact
While electric vehicles produce zero emissions at the tailpipe, the production and disposal of batteries do have environmental implications. Innovations in battery technology, such as recycling programs and improved battery chemistries, are essential for mitigating these impacts. The future of EV batteries looks promising, with ongoing research into solid-state batteries and alternative materials that could enhance energy density and charging speed. As electric vehicles become more mainstream, advancements in battery technology will play a pivotal role in the transportation industry.
